"Three Great Baroque Architects"

The National Gallery of Ancient Art (Galleria Nazionale d'Arte Antica) houses works by Caravaggio, Raffaello, Tintoretto, and Holbein, among many others. These paintings belong to the Barberini family's massive collection, most of which is scattered all over the world. Baroque architects Maderno, Bernini, and Borromini designed the palace. Two grand staircases lead to the main floor: the larger one was designed by Bernini and the smaller, oval construction by Borromini. On the first floor, the large ceiling of the Salone (main hall) was covered in frescoed by Piertro da Cortona and depicts the triumph of Pope Urban VIII. You'll notice the Bernini family symbol, a bee, painted or sculpted almost everywhere in the building.
